A club statement following his resignation read: Keegan returned to football on 25 September 1997 as "chief operating officer" (a similar role to a director of football) at Division Two club Fulham, with Ray Wilkins as head coach. His appointment came a few months after the takeover of the club by Harrods owner Mohamed Al-Fayed, who gave Keegan 10 million to spend on players that season as the first part of a 40 million attempt to deliver Premier League football to the Craven Cottage club, who had been outside the top flight since 1968 and had not even played in the league's second tier since 1986. Keegan was unable to inspire Fulham to overcome Grimsby Town in the playoffs, but good form in 199899 helped by the acquisition of more players who would normally have been signed by Premier League or Division one clubs clinched them the Division Two title and promotion to Division One, but Keegan left at the end of the season to concentrate on his duties as England manager, having succeeded Glenn Hoddle in February 1999. Kevin Keegan started his career at Scunthorpe, making his debut in 1967 before moving to Liverpool in May 1971, the week of Liverpool's FA Cup Final defeat to Arsenal. At Hamburg, he was named European Footballer of the Year in 1978 and 1979, won the Bundesliga title in 197879, and reached the European Cup final in 1980.
